Abstract
Periostin is a matricellular glutamate-containing protein expressed during ontogenesis and in adult connective tissues submitted to mechanical strains including bone and, more specifically, the periosteum, periodontal ligaments, tendons, heart valves, or skin. It is also expressed in neoplastic tissues, cardiovascular and fibrotic diseases, and during wound repair. Its biological functions are extensively investigated in fields such as cardiovascular physiology or oncology. Despite its initial identification in bone, investigations of periostin functions in bone-related physiopathology are less abundant. Recently, several studies have analyzed the potential role of periostin in bone biology and suggest that periostin may be an important regulator of bone formation. The aim of this article is to provide an extensive review on the implications of periostin in bone biology and its potential use in benign and metabolic bone diseases.

Abstract
Bone tissue is densely innervated, and there is increasing evidence for a neural control of bone metabolism. Semaphorin-3A is a very important regulator of neuronal targeting in the peripheral nervous system as well as in angiogenesis, and knockout of the Semaphorin-3A gene induces abnormal bone and cartilage development. We analyzed the spatial and temporal expression patterns of Semaphorin-3A signaling molecules during endochondral ossification, in parallel with the establishment of innervation. We show that osteoblasts and chondrocytes differentiated in vitro express most members of the Semaphorin-3A signaling system (Semaphorin-3A, Neuropilin-1, and Plexins-A1 and -A2). In vitro, osteoclasts express most receptor chains but not the ligand. In situ, these molecules are all expressed in the periosteum and by resting, prehypertrophic and hypertrophic chondrocytes in ossification centers before the onset of neurovascular invasion. They are detected later in osteoblasts and also osteoclasts, with differences in intensity and regional distribution. Semaphorin-3A and Neuropilin-1 are also expressed in the bone marrow. Plexin-A3 is not expressed by bone cell lineages in vitro. It is detected early in the periosteum and hypertrophic chondrocytes. After the onset of ossification, this chain is restricted to a network of cell processes in close vicinity to the cells lining the trabeculae, similar to the pattern observed for neural markers at the same stages. After birth, while the density of innervation decreases, Plexin-A3 is strongly expressed by blood vessels on the ossification front. In conclusion, Semaphorin-3A signaling is present in bone and seems to precede or coincide at the temporal but also spatial level with the invasion of bone by blood vessels and nerve fibers. Expression patterns suggest Plexin-A3/Neuropilin-1 as a candidate receptor in target cells for the regulation of bone innervation by Semaphorin-3A.

Abstract
Primary bone cell cultures were derived from human bone explants. Cellular activity was characterized by the alkaline phosphatase (AP) activity, osteocalcin, and type I and III collagen secretions in the supernatant. The determination of bone cell activity was performed in three different wells. No significant difference was noted between wells: the coefficient of variation was 8.0 +/- 2.9% for AP activity, 18.3 +/- 1.9% for osteocalcin secretion, and 22.5 +/- 14.3% for collagen. The AP activity and osteocalcin secretion significantly decreased with the number of passages: they were the highest after the first passage. Between each subject, the coefficient of variation was 85% for AP activity and osteocalcin secretion and 63 and 57% for type I and III collagen secretion, respectively. The AP activity did not differ with the age or sex of the donor. In contrast, osteocalcin secretion was significantly lower in females than in males. In males, osteocalcin significantly decreased with the age of the donor (r = -0.61; p less than 0.05). Cellular activity did not depend on the site of the biopsy. When bone explants from one donor were cultured in two different petri dishes, the activity of cells was similar in both dishes, except in one case. Primary cell cultures derived from human bone explants are the only model providing untransformed osteoblastlike cells of human origin. Because of the experimental conditions, some factors may have influenced the cellular activity and they must be taken into account to validate further in vitro studies.

Abstract
The N-methyl-D-aspartate (NMDA) subtype of the glutamate receptor has recently been identified in bone, but the molecular composition of this receptor expressed by bone cells is unknown. NMDA receptor (NMDAR) is a hetero-oligomeric protein composed of two classes of subunits, the essential subunit NR1 and NR2A to D subunits that do not by themselves produce functional channels but potentiate NR1 activity and confer functional variability to the receptor. These subunits coassemble in different combinations to form functionally distinct NMDAR. In this study, we have investigated the molecular composition of NMDAR expressed by osteoblasts and osteoclasts in culture, using RT-PCR analysis, in situ hybridization and immunocytochemistry. Specific probes were designed for the different subunits of the NMDAR, and we showed by RT-PCR analysis that mammalian osteoclasts expressed NR2B and NR2D subunits mRNAs but not NR2A and NR2C mRNAs. Rat calvaria and MG63 osteoblastic cells also expressed several NR2 subunits mRNAs, namely NR2A, NR2B, and NR2D. In situ hybridization on isolated rabbit osteoclasts and MG63 cells has confirmed the localization of NR1, NR2B, and NR2D transcripts in osteoclasts and NR1, NR2A, NR2B, and NR2D transcripts in MG63 cells. The expression of NR2D protein by bone cells was shown by immunofluorescence. These results demonstrate for the first time that osteoblasts and osteoclasts express several NR2 subunits, suggesting a molecular diversity of NMDAR channels similar to what was shown for brain. The presence of distinct functional NMDAR on bone cells may be associated with various states of bone cell differentiation and function.

Abstract
Serum osteocalcin (bone Gla-protein), a specific marker of osteoblastic activity, is only moderately increased in patients with active Paget's disease of bone, despite biochemical evidence of increased bone turnover. Because pagetic bone has an abnormal texture, such a discrepancy could be due to an abnormal carboxylation of osteocalcin. To test this hypothesis, we measured the fraction of decarboxylated osteocalcin in the serum of 11 patients with active Paget's disease of bone by the hydroxyapatite binding technique and the data were compared to those obtained in 10 controls and in 10 patients on vitamin K antagonist therapy. In contrast to the decreased decarboxylated fraction of osteocalcin in warfarin-treated patients (27 +/- 2.2%, P less than 0.01 vs controls), the fraction of decarboxylated osteocalcin was normal in pagetic patients (8.9 +/- 2.2% vs 6.5 +/- 1.7% in controls, n.s.). These data suggest that there is no abnormality of the osteocalcin carboxylation in Paget's disease. The disproportionate levels of circulating osteocalcin compared to the marked elevation of alkaline phosphatase in that disease could be due to other factors such as an increased binding of the protein to the woven bone matrix.

Abstract
Five long sleepers (LS) and 5 short sleepers (SS) were selected from 310 medical students. Nine regular sleepers (RS) were used as a control. The sleep was recorded during 3 reference nights, one recovery night after a 36 h sleep deprivation (R2), one morning sleep after a 24 h sleep deprivation (D1) and the night following D1(R1). According to previous data slow wave sleep (SWS) amounts were the same in the 3 groups while stage 2 and paradoxical sleep (PS) amounts increased with the sleep duration. The hourly distribution of intervening wakefulness and SWS were similar for all groups. When compared to RS or SS the hourly distribution in LS of PS was lower until the sixth hour. As a function of experimental conditions, sleep patterns of LS were the most affected. In R2 the sleep of LS more closely resembled that of RS or SS than in reference nights, while in R1 LS' sleep was the most disturbed. Morning sleep durations were very similar for all groups, but in LS intervening wakefulness was increased and PS was decreased when compared to RS and SS. Negative correlations (Spearman rank test) were found between the morning increase of body temperature after a sleep-deprived night and both TST and PS durations. In all recorded sleep periods, SWS amounts were positively correlated with prior wakefulness duration and the PS amount with TST.

Abstract
Osteoporosis (OP) is a major public health concern, but still OP care does not meet guidelines. Interventions have been developed to improve appropriate OP management. The objective of the present study was to systematically review the current literature to ascertain the efficacy of interventions to improve OP care and characterize interventions taking into account elements related to their potential cost and feasibility. Studies published from 2003 to 2018 were retrieved from PubMed/MEDLINE, Science Direct, Web of Science, Cochrane, and Wiley Online Library databases. Screening of references and quality assessment were independently performed by two reviewers. We classified interventions into three types according to the target of the intervention: health system (structural interventions), healthcare professional (HCP), and patient. Meta-analysis was performed by type of intervention and their effect on two outcomes: prescription of BMD measurement and prescription of OP therapy. A total of 4268 records were screened; 32 studies were included in the qualitative analysis and 29 studies in the quantitative analysis. Structural interventions strongly and significantly improved prescription of BMD measurement (OR = 9.99, 95% CI 2.05; 48.59) and treatment prescription (OR = 3.82, 95% CI 2.16; 6.75). The impact of HCP-centered interventions on BMD measurement prescription did not reach statistical significance (OR = 2.19, 95% CI 0.84; 5.73) but significantly improved treatment prescription (OR = 3.82, 95% CI 2.16; 6.75). Interventions involving patients significantly improved the prescription of BMD measurement (OR = 2.16, 95% CI 1.62; 2.89) and treatment prescription (OR = 1.70, 95% CI 1.35; 2.14). Interventions to improve OP management had a significant positive impact on prescription of BMD measurement but a more limited impact on treatment prescription.

Abstract
We developed a sensitive and specific radioimmunoassay for ovine bone gla-protein (osteocalcin) using a polyclonal rabbit antibody raised against ovine bone gla-protein. Bone from lambs was extracted in 0.5 mol/l EDTA and desalted on Sephadex G-25. Bone gla-protein was purified by gel filtration chromatography over Sephadex G-100 and ion-exchange chromatography on DEAE-Sephadex A-25. The protein, subjected to monodimensional electrophoresis migrated as a single spot in SDS PAGE with the same apparent molecular weight of 12 kD as bovine bone gla-protein. The amino acid composition of purified bone gla-protein was in agreement with a previous publication. The competitive RIA uses 125I-labelled bone gla-protein as a tracer and a complex of a second antibody and polyethylene glycol to separate free and antibody-bound 125I-labelled bone gla-protein. The intra- and inter-assay variations are less than 6 and 10%, respectively. There is no reactivity of our antisera with dog sera. The cross-reactivity is only partial with calf and human sera and complete with ovine sera. We measured bone gla-protein levels in serum of 96 normal male sheep of different ages. Serum bone gla-protein rapidly and significantly (P less than 0.001) decreased from 535 +/- 169 microgram/l at birth, to 240 +/- 43 microgram/l at 45 days, 152 +/- 44 micrograms/l at 90 days, and 5.9 +/- 0.7 microgram/l at 7 years of age.(ABSTRACT TRUNCATED AT 250 WORDS)

Abstract
UNLABELLED We conducted a multicenter, randomized controlled trial to evaluate the impact of a population-based patient-centered post-fracture care program with a dedicated case manager, PREVention of OSTeoporosis (PREVOST), on appropriate post-fracture osteoporosis management. We showed that, compared to usual care, BMD investigation post-fracture was significantly improved (+20%) by our intervention program. INTRODUCTION Our study aims to evaluate the impact of a population-based patient-centered post-fracture care program, PREVOST, on appropriate post-fracture care. METHODS Multicenter, randomized controlled trial enrolling 436 women aged 50 to 85 years and attending a French hospital, for a low-energy fracture of the wrist or humerus. Randomization was stratified by age, hospital department, and site of fracture. The intervention was performed by a trained case manager who interacted only with the patients, with repeated oral and written information about fragility fractures and osteoporosis management, and prompting them to visit their primary care physicians. Control group received usual care. The primary outcome was the initiation of an appropriate post-fracture care defined by Bone Mineral Density (BMD) and/or anti-osteoporotic treatment prescription at 6 months. RESULTS At 6 months, 53% of women in intervention group initiated a post-fracture care versus 33% for usual care (adjOR 2.35, 95%CI [1.58-3.50], p < 0.001). Post-fracture care was more frequent after wrist than humerus fracture (adjOR 1.93, 95%CI [1.14-3.30], p = 0.015) and decreased with age (adjOR for 10 years increase 0.76, 95%CI [0.61-0.96], p = 0.02). The intervention resulted in BMD prescription in 50% of patients (adjOR 2.10, 95%CI [1.41-3.11], p < 0.001) and in BMD performance in 41% of patients (adjOR 2.12, 95%CI [1.40-3.20], p < 0.001) versus 33 and 25% for usual care, respectively. Having performed a BMD increased treatment prescription; however, only 46% of women with a low BMD requiring a treatment according to the French guidelines received a prescription. CONCLUSION A patient-centered care program with a dedicated case manager can significantly improve post-fracture BMD investigation.

Abstract
UNLABELLED We conducted a qualitative study with French men and women in order to provide insight into individuals' experiences, behaviors, and perceptions about osteoporosis (OP) and OP care. The data showed that both sexes, but especially men, were unfamiliar with OP, did not always feel concerned, and mistrusted pharmacological treatments. INTRODUCTION To engage actively in osteoporosis (OP) prevention, people need to have basic knowledge about the disease. The aim of this qualitative study was to explore knowledge and representations of OP care and prevention among both men and women. METHODS Focus groups were conducted in the Rhône-Alpes Region, France, with women aged 50-85 years and men aged 60-85 years, with or without a history of fragility fracture and/or an OP diagnosis (respectively referred to as "aware" or "unaware"). A total of 45 women (23 "aware" and 22 "unaware" in 5 and 4 focus groups, respectively) and 53 men (19 "aware" and 34 "unaware" in 3 and 4 focus groups, respectively) were included. A thematic analysis of transcripts was performed to explore knowledge and representations about OP, risk factors, prevention, and treatment. RESULTS The data showed that both sexes, but especially men, had limited knowledge of OP and considered it as a natural aging process not related to fragility fractures. They generally did not feel concerned by OP and no important difference was observed between "aware" and "unaware" patients. Women expressed their fear of the disease, associated with aging and the end of life, while men considered it to be a women's disease only. Both sexes were aware of OP risk factors, but were suspicious towards treatments because of the associated side effects. CONCLUSION Understanding people's representation of OP might help to provide patients with relevant information in order to optimize their preventive behavior and decrease the burden of the disease.

Abstract
Fibrous dysplasia of bone (FD) is a rare congenital bone disease, characterized by a fibrous component in the bone marrow. Periostin has been extensively researched because of its implication in various fibrotic or inflammatory diseases. Periostin may be associated with the burden or the severity of FD. The case control PERIOSDYS study aimed at assessing serum periostin levels in FD patients. Sixty four patients with monostotic or polyostotic disease were included, in order to evaluate whether the concentrations were greater in patients than in 128 healthy age, BMI and sex-matched controls and if they were more elevated in patients with the more severe phenotypes. We found that periostin levels were greater in patients with FD compared to controls (mean = 1085 vs 958 pmol/l, p = 0.026), especially in those with a history of fracture (mean = 1475 vs 966 pmol/l, p = 0.0005), polyostotic forms (mean = 1214 vs 955 pmol/l, p = 0.004) or McCune-Albright syndrome (mean = 1585 vs 1023 pmol/l, p = 0.0048). In contrast, high pain levels were not associated with periostin levels (mean = 1137 vs 1036 pmol/l, p = 0.445). Furthermore, patients undergoing bisphosphonate therapy had significantly lower levels than treatment naïve patients (mean = 953 vs 1370 pmol/l, p = 0.002). In conclusion, periostin may be a biochemical marker indicative of the most severe forms of FD and could be used to monitor patients treated with bisphosphonates.

Abstract
Six habitual long (greater than or equal to 9 hr) sleepers (LS) and 6 habitual short (less than or equal to 6.5 hr) sleepers (SS) measured their diurnal axillary temperature (T) every 4 hr from awakening time to bedtime. For the control span of 10 days, temperature peak time was similar in both groups but occurred later in SS than in LS when measured from midsleep. Bedtime was closer to temperature peak time in LS than in SS. While experiencing the same sleep deprivations (SD 24 hr with morning sleep recovery and SD 36 hr with nocturnal sleep recovery). SS maintained a more stable body temperature curve than LS. After the nights of sleep deprivation, morning temperature increased in LS but not in SS. In both experimental conditions LS tended to advance their temperature peaks. This shift resulted in a statistically significant difference between the groups' T peaks for the 36-hour sleep deprivation. These results suggest that coupling between sleep/activity rhythm and temperature rhythm probably is different in LS and in SS, being stronger in LS.

Abstract
Spontaneous spinal epidural haematomas are quite rare. We report here the case of a 27-year-old woman, without previous history of relevant medical disorder, who presented with acute paraplegia at 36 weeks of gestation. MRI performed in emergency revealed a T8 epidural haematoma. The management consisted in an emergency Caesarean section under general anaesthesia, followed immediately by a T8 laminectomy allowing the spinal cord decompression 14 hours after the first symptoms. Neurologic recovery was rapid and complete, except for bladder dysfunction persisting one month later. Spontaneous spinal epidural haematomas require a prompt diagnosis because neurologic prognosis essentially depends on the interval of time between onset of symptoms and surgical decompression. Obstetrical management especially depends on the term of pregnancy. For the anaesthesiologist, the difficulty is the management of both pregnant condition (full stomach general anaesthesia) and spinal cord compression (maintenance of spinal cord perfusion pression and limitation of ischaemia and oedema).

Abstract
OBJECTIVES Our primary aims were to assess current prevalence of HOA and the disability associated with this condition, in the group usually most affected, i.e., women older than 55. METHODS We performed hand radiographs, clinical examination, grip strength measurement, AUSCAN and COCHIN questionnaires in a cohort of postmenopausal women aged at least 55. Radiographic hand OA (RHOA) was defined as at least 2 affected joints among 30, grading 2 or more using the Kellgren Lawrence score but without any HOA symptom. Symptomatic HOA (OA ACR) was defined according to ACR criteria for hand OA. Moderate to severe symptomatic HOA was defined as having OA ACR and AUSCAN total score of >43/100. RESULTS We enrolled 1,189 participants. The mean age was 71.7 years. Inter-reader reliability of radiographs reading was good (ICC = 0.86) and intra-reader reliability was excellent (ICC = 0.97). Among the 1,189 women, 333 (28.0%) had RHOA, 482 (40.5%) patients fulfilled the ACR criteria for symptomatic HOA and 82 of these (17% of OA ACR population) had moderate to severe symptomatic HOA. The prevalence of symptomatic erosive osteoarthritis was 11.8%. Mean AUSCAN and Cochin scores were higher and grip strength lower in patients with symptomatic HOA compared to patient without HOA. Differences were more noticeable in patients with moderate to severe HOA. CONCLUSIONS We have assessed disability associated with HOA in greater detail than previously and found that a third of postmenopausal women had RHOA, two fifths had symptomatic HOA and one sixth of symptomatic patients had moderate to severe HOA related disability and a tenth had symptomatic erosive osteoarthritis, representing a substantial burden of disease in our population-based cohort.

Abstract
Skin decorin (DCN) is an antiadhesive dermatan sulfate-rich proteoglycan that interacts with thrombospondin-1 (TSP) and inhibits fibroblast adhesion to TSP [Winnemöller et al., 1992]. Molecular mechanisms by which DCN interacts with TSP and inhibits cell adhesion to TSP are unknown. In the present study, we showed that skin DCN and bone DCN (chondroitin sulfate-rich proteoglycan) were quantitatively identical with respect to their ability to interact with TSP. Using a series of fusion proteins corresponding to the different structural domains of TSP, binding of [125I]DCN to TSP was found to be dependent of the N-terminal domain and, to a lesser extent, of the type 1 repeats and the C-terminal domain of TSP. In addition, heparan sulfate drastically inhibited [125I]DCN binding to solid-phase adsorbed TSP (80% inhibition), suggesting that DCN could bind to the N-terminal domain of TSP through interaction with heparin-binding sequences. To address this question, a series of synthetic peptides, overlapping heparin-binding sequences ARKGSGRR (residues 22-29), KKTR (residues 80-83) and RLRIAKGGVNDN (residues 178-189), were synthesized and tested for their ability to interact with DCN. [125I]DCN interacted only with peptides VDAVRTEKGFLLLASLRQMKKTRGT and KKTRGTLLALERKDHS containing the heparin-binding consensus sequence KKTR. These peptides contained glycosaminoglycan-dependent and -independent binding sites because [125I]DCN binding to VDAVRTEKGFLLLASLRQMKKTRGT and KKTRGTLLALERKDHS was partially reduced upon removal of the glycosaminoglycan chain (65% and 46% inhibition, respectively). [125I]DCN poorly bound to subpeptide MKKTRG and did not bind at all to subpeptides VDAVRTEKGFLLLASLRQ and TLLALERKDHS, suggesting that heparin-binding sequence MKKTRG constituted a DCN binding site when flanked with peptides VDAVRTEKGFLLLASLRQ and TLLALERKDHS. The sequence VDAVRTEKGFLLLASLRQMKKTRGTLLALERKDHS constitutes a cell adhesive active site in the N-terminal domain of TSP [Clezardin et al., 1997], and DCN inhibited the attachment of fibroblastic and osteoblastic cells to peptides VDAVRTEKGFLLLASLRQMKKTRGT and KKTRGTLLALERKDHS by about 50 and 80%, respectively. Although fibroblastic cells also attached to type 3 repeats and the C-terminal domain of TSP, DCN only inhibited cell attachment to the C-terminal domain. Overall, these data indicate that modulation by steric exclusion of cell adhesion to a KKTR-dependent cell adhesive site present within the N-terminal domain of TSP could explain the antiadhesive properties of DCN.

Abstract
Age-related macular degeneration (AMD) is the leading cause of vision loss in France and in other industrialized countries. AMD affects around 20 % of the population over the age of 80 years. This complex and multifactorial disease involves both genetic susceptibility and environmental factors. Smoking and nutrition are well-known modifiable risk factors for AMD. Numerous studies provide convincing arguments in favor of micronutrients to encourage dietary advice and the prescription of nutritional supplements containing antioxidant vitamins, lutein and omega-3 fatty acids. Attention to modifiable risk factors is of utmost importance to reduce progression to advanced AMD and associated medical and societal burdens.

Abstract
Several studies overwhelmingly support the notion that decorin (DCN) is involved in matrix assembly, and in the control of cell adhesion and proliferation. However, nothing is known about the role of DCN during cell migration. Cell migration is a tightly regulated process which requires both adhesion (at the leading edge of the cell) and de-adhesion (at the trailing edge of the cell) from the substratum. We have determined in this study the effect of DCN on MG-63 osteosarcoma cell migration and have analyzed whether its effect is mediated by the protein core and/or the glycosaminoglycan side chain. DCN impeded the migration-promoting effect of matrix molecules (fibronectin, collagen type I) known to interact with the proteoglycan. Conversely, DCN did not counteract the migration-promoting effect of fibrinogen lacking proteoglycan affinity. DCN bearing dermatan-sulfate chains (i.e., skin and cartilage DCN) was about 20-fold more effective in inhibiting cell migration than DCN bearing chondroitin-sulfate chains (i.e., bone DCN). In addition, chondroitinase AC-treatment of cartilage DCN (which specifically removes chondroitin-sulfate chains) did not attenuate the inhibitory effect of this proteoglycan, while cartilage DCN deprived of both chondroitin- and dermatan-sulfate chains failed to alter cell migration promoted by either fibronectin or its heparin- and cell-binding domains. These data assert that the dermatan-sulfate chains of DCN are responsible for a negative influence on cell migration. However, isolated glycosaminoglycans failed to alter cell migration promoted by fibronectin, indicating that strongly negatively charged glycosaminoglycans alone cannot account for the impaired cell motility seen with DCN. Overall, these results show that the inhibitory action of DCN is dependent of substratum binding, is differentially mediated by its glycosaminoglycan side chains (chondroitin-sulfate vs. dermatan-sulfate chains), and is independent of a steric hindrance effect exerted by its glycosaminoglycan side chains.

Abstract
Seven long sleepers (LS) (sleep greater than or equal to 9 h) and seven short sleepers (SS) (sleep less than or equal to 7 h), aged 20 to 23 years, were selected among medical students. They measured their axillary temperature (T), heart rate (HR) and self-estimated their vigilance (V) and mood (M) every 4 h from awakening to bed time during a ten-day control span and during the two sleep deprived nights. Polygraphic sleep recordings were performed on 3 control days and recovery from 24 h (day sleep) or 36 h (night sleep) sleep deprivations. For the 4 variables (T, HR, V and M), group circadian patterns were analyzed by means of the cosinor method for the control span and after both types of sleep deprivation. The acrophases of the 4 variables clustered more in LS than in SS. The acrophases of V and M were found to be more closely related to the sleep/wake rhythm than those of T and HR. Sleep deprivation resulted in a large change of the circadian rhythms in LS but had little effect in SS as indicated by the non detection of most acrophases in LS and the persistence of such acrophases in SS. This difference might be explained by the large interindividual variability of changes induced by the sleep deprivation in LS. Moreover, day sleep recovery was more disturbed in LS than in SS.

Abstract
Serum bone Gamma-carboxyglutamic acid (bone-gla) protein (BGP), a marker of bone formation, was measured in serial blood samples drawn from 14 patients who had fractured at least one of their tibial or femoral diaphyses and from two other patients who had sustained major trauma without fracture but who had been immobilized. A total of 85 samples were taken and analyzed during the first three months after the fractures occurred. Serum BGP significantly increased and positively correlated with the time that had elapsed after the fracture, with an average twofold increase after two months. The fracture site and the duration of immobilization had no influence on the serum BGP levels. Serum BGP levels from the two non-fractured cases increased in the first two weeks with no subsequent consistent trend. These data suggest that serum BGP increases one to two months after a major fracture, possibly as a manifestation of bone repair. Further studies are required to determine the potential clinical value of serum BGP in the management of such patients.
